Microcirculation is very crucial to evaluate the organ function those working properly in human body. The aim of the present study is to assess the effects of brachial plexus block on microcirculation using pefusion index and capillary filling time. A total of 50 patients whose planned to underwent surgery are performed brachial plexus block using ultrasound, and pefusion index, heart rate, blood pressure, capillary filling time are measured at 0, 10th and 20th minutes interval and at postoperative 24th hours. All measures will be recorded.
